From the minds behind illuminating conversations such as Things That Suck: A History, and Let's Face It: The World Is Mad, comes a future award-winning podcast offering an interesting, informative, irresistible, irredeemable, irreverent, insolent, and insightful exploration of literary works from a century past. Don't miss our barn-burning, page-turning fun as we find out how or whether these classics hold up after 100 years, and learn about contemporary issues that affected their writing.



It's time for the Gutenberg Deep Dive!

    Episode 06 - Main Street

    Episode 06 - Main Street

    In our sixth episode, Jon and Mike discuss Main Street by Sinclair Lewis ( Free at http://www.gutenberg.org/ebooks/543 ). This is the highest-rated book on this podcast to date, and written by a Nobel Prize winner, so you may want to read it first (and you can listen to this podcast in a year when you finish this tome!)
